  • A soft structures carrier like an ergo will probably be easiest to put on. A wrap does have a bit o a learning curve, I reccommend a woven wrap since those can be used up through the toddler/preschool years. You can even get two wraps and wear both at the same time. I even wear my 14 month old while pregnant, and walked aroun all day at Disney no problem.

  • I LOVE moby's in the beginning.  I made a mai tei for later this time because the moby is hard to put on in the parking lot.  I also have slings for short trips in the grocery store and stuff like that.

  • We went through a Bjorn and a Moby Wrap and finally settled on an Ergo which we LOVE and still use for DD. She is almost 30 pounds now and it is still super comfortable and DH loves wearing it.
  • I LOVE the Ergo. Starting using it right away with my 3rd because brothers were always playing sports. She is 3 now and I still use it when we go on hikes. Once you figure it out it is easy to put on by yourself.
